Red Hat OpenShift Container Platform is an open source, enterprise-grade Kubernetes platform for building, deploying, and managing containerized applications across on-premise, private cloud and public cloud infrastructure.

Checkmk

Checkmk is a full-stack monitoring and observability platform designed to provide unified visibility into hybrid IT infrastructures. With more than 2,000 built-in integrations, it offers broad coverage across networks, servers, cloud workloads, Kubernetes and applications. The platform is highly automated, featuring auto-discovery of hosts and services and rule-based configuration to reduce manual setup. It is highly scalable, capable of efficiently monitoring thousands of hosts and millions of services. A central web-based interface allows users to manage configuration, visualize data with customizable dashboards, and track system performance over time. Checkmk is available as packages for all common Linux distributions, as a virtual or physical appliance, through AWS and Azure Marketplace images, or as SaaS. Checkmk is available in four editions: Checkmk Community offers free and open source monitoring for small infrastructures. Checkmk Pro allows for monitoring at speed and scale for data center infrastructures. Checkmk Ultimate offers full-stack observability for hybrid and cloud-native infrastructures which is also available with multi-tenancy and data segregation to support security and compliance. And Checkmk Cloud for full-stack observability for hybrid and cloud-native infrastructures in a SaaS platform. What are Container Monitoring Tools?

Container monitoring tools monitor running containers, collect container activity logs, and analyze the data to provide observability and insights into container performance.

Containers are ephemeral. It means that they are deleted once their work is complete. So it becomes necessary to continuously collect data and move it to a centralized location to ensure the data is not lost. Container monitoring solutions provide visibility and real-time insights into these highly dynamic containers.

Container monitoring is not very straightforward. Container environments have multiple elements—container hosts, container engines, cluster management systems, and microservices. Failure of any of these elements can affect container performance. This inflates the number of components that container monitoring tools must track. In addition, several layers of abstraction between containers and hardware ensure they can run anywhere. While this is one of the most significant advantages containers offer, monitoring is much more difficult. Containers share resources, which makes monitoring them more tricky. Container monitoring systems can come to the rescue here as they help observe and keep track of the highly elusive containers. Container monitoring systems generally capture metrics such as CPU usage, cache memory usage, network traffic, and time-series data. The information thus collected is compared with preset thresholds to identify anomalies and alert the concerned teams. Most container monitoring tools also provide visualizations and dashboards to enable users to get insights about container health and performance easily. 

What Types of Container Monitoring Tools Exist?

The following are the different types of container monitoring tools that exist.

Open-source container monitoring solutions

Open-source container monitoring products often have a lower price point than proprietary software and may even be free. These options may be better for smaller businesses that do not need expansive, feature-rich products. One important point to note is that most open-source products have little or no support staff behind them. So buyers should ensure they have a good in-house development team when implementing one. 

Proprietary container monitoring solutions

Proprietary container monitoring software offers more powerful features and performance than open-source software. It also has a more robust support structure for implementation and maintenance. However, it can be expensive. Moreover, some features might be part of the proprietary software package, which is irrelevant to the buyer’s business. This can unnecessarily add up costs. 

What are the Common Features of Container Monitoring Tools?

The following are some core features within container monitoring tools that can help users:

Dashboards and visualizations: Container monitoring is complex. Dashboards and data visualizations present information in a highly digestible format for easy sharing, monitoring, and analysis. It can also provide insights at multiple levels of granularity, which helps the user drill down to the exact pods, containers, and clusters to identify the root cause of the issues.

Architecture display: Container monitoring tools create a graphical representation of services, integrations, and IT infrastructure associated with a container ecosystem. This allows users quick access and the ability to browse information easily.

Anomaly detection: Anomaly detection features let users automate systems to constantly monitor user behavior activity and compare it to benchmarked patterns.

Performance baseline: Baselines and benchmarks are used to set a standard performance level against which the user can compare live applications and infrastructure activities.

Real-time monitoring: Real-time monitoring automates constant monitoring processes for applications and IT infrastructure to detect anomalies in real time.

Alerting: Alerting features notify relevant stakeholders via modes, such as emails and messages, when the performance goes below predefined thresholds.

API monitoring: API monitoring traces connections between different containerized environments and detects anomalies in functionality, user accessibility, traffic flows, and tampering.

Configuration monitoring: This feature allows users to monitor configuration rule sets, enforce policy measures, and document changes to maintain compliance.

Improvement suggestions: When issues are identified, this functionality provides the user with suggestions for improvement, giving information about potential remedies or improvements to prevent slowdowns, errors, or failures.

Automation: Automation features help scale the usage of resources. Automation also monitors operations to optimize visibility and responds in real time based on fluctuations in usage.

What are the Benefits of Container Monitoring Tools?

These are some of the benefits that container monitoring platforms provide:

Faster, proactive issue resolution: Container monitoring tools work by collecting application metrics and dependencies. The tools use this information to set a baseline for performance metrics and help identify abnormalities. As issues arise, container monitoring solutions alert administrative staff and allow for real-time observation of application and infrastructure performance. 

Detailed visuals: This helps the user quickly drill down to the root causes of issues presented and improves the team’s ability to quickly fix them, minimizing the impact on end-users and customers.

Improved performance: One of the most important benefits of container monitoring tools is their ability to improve application performance. The tools provide a window into resource usage, redundancies, and inefficiencies. This helps companies evaluate their resources and apps and fine-tune them to achieve the best performance.

Safety net for change implementation: Any changes that the development teams deploy are constantly monitored. The tools immediately detect and notify the developers of any issues or vulnerabilities, allowing teams to take quick actions to remediate the problems.

Who Uses Container Monitoring Tools?

The following personnel most commonly use container monitoring software.

IT administrators: IT administrators use container monitoring software to monitor their container applications and ensure overall system health and performance. The software helps IT administrators detect issues, troubleshoot, balance system workloads, allocate resources efficiently, and improve the performance of running containers.

Developers: Developers use container monitoring software to keep a pulse on their apps and ensure a consistent, quality user experience. This tool allows developers to compare performance metrics against desired benchmarks and effectively begin remediation when performance issues arise.

What are the Alternatives to Container Monitoring Tools?

Alternatives to container monitoring software that can replace this type of software, either partially or completely:

Application performance monitoring (APM) tools: Application performance monitoring solutions help users track and visualize application obstructions and help troubleshoot any future predictable issues. They also facilitate real-time insights through dashboards into application performance and trigger timely alerts for issues like a disturbance in load or response times. 

Cloud infrastructure monitoring software: Cloud infrastructure monitoring software allows companies to visualize and track the performance of their cloud-native applications or services. These tools aggregate real-time data to display information related to a company’s cloud-based resources. These tools can track application performance, network availability, and resource allocation, among other cloud-related factors.

Software Related to Container Monitoring Tools

Related solutions that can be used together with container monitoring tools include:

Container management software: Container management software adds a level of abstraction to the container engine’s instance. It simplifies administrative processes to automate container creation, deployment, and scaling processes, saving companies time and money.

Container orchestration software: Container orchestration software plays a significant role in the overall container lifecycle. These tools interact with the apps running inside their respective containers. They maintain the container’s performance and allow developers to implement updates or rollbacks quickly. Container orchestration software is typically used by companies that maintain many containers. They make it easier to manage system configurations. Many of these solutions come bundled with container management tools to simplify integration, and several options exist for the user.

Container networking software: Some containers rely on other containers for data; others only hold an application's components. All containers rely on network accessibility for proper functionality. Container networking software helps users define networks and connect containers across multiple hosts. Efficiently networked containers create a decentralized architecture where parts of an application can be added or removed without affecting availability. These tools make it easier to scale apps, manage configurations, and secure application networks.

Container security software: Container security software often provides several monitoring capabilities. However, these monitoring functions differ as they are specifically designed for security rather than performance. Also, monitoring will not be the product’s core functionality. These tools facilitate various security functions, from access control and user provisioning to vulnerability assessment and advanced threat protection.

Challenges with Container Monitoring Tools

Container monitoring solutions can come with their own set of challenges. 

Scalability: Some tools are designed to monitor single applications. Others might be capable of performing real-time monitoring on multiple globally distributed applications. This should be a key consideration for adoption. There are various monitoring tools specialized for small businesses or enterprise companies. Depending on the size and scope of a company’s application portfolio, some monitoring tools might be better than others for a specific company’s needs.

Infrastructure access: Infrastructure accessibility can be essential in diagnosing and troubleshooting issues with containerized applications. On-premises servers are easier to access but often require constant attention and have a considerable up-front cost. Cloud services, used mainly by DevOps teams, may require a high level of customizability to suit a company’s needs. This might impact a company’s direct access to logs and incident details.

How to Buy Container Monitoring Tools

Requirements Gathering (RFI/RFP) for Container Monitoring Tools

Some important things to consider while buying a container monitoring software are the number of metrics it provides and if they are the most relevant ones for the buyer. The tool must also provide easy log management as well as alerting and visualization capabilities, with machine learning capabilities an added advantage. Many vendors also offer solutions with a large bouquet of features. Buyers must carefully evaluate the relevance of those features to their requirements before splurging more money into proprietary software.

Compare Container Monitoring Software Products

Create a long list

Buyers need to identify features that they need from their container monitoring tools and start with a large pool of container monitoring software vendors. Buyers must then evaluate the pros and cons of each product.

Create a short list

Short lists help cross-reference the results of initial vendor evaluations with other buyer reviews on third-party review sites such as g2.com, which will help the buyer narrow in on a three to five product list. From there, buyers can compare pricing and features to determine the best fit.

Conduct demos

Companies should demo all of the products on their short list. During demos, buyers should ask specific questions about the functionalities they care about most; for example, one might ask for a demo of how the tool would behave when it detects a particular performance issue.

Selection of Container Monitoring Tools

Choose a selection team

Regardless of a company’s size, involving the most relevant personnel is crucial during the container monitoring software selection process. The team should include relevant company stakeholders who can use the software, scrutinize it, and check whether it will meet the organization’s requirements. The individuals responsible for the day-to-day use of container monitoring tools must be a part of the selection team. IT administrators, developers, and decision makers could be the primary personas included in the group.

Negotiation

The cost of the monitoring software varies based on the features offered, the number of nodes, and users. Buyers looking to trim costs should try to negotiate down to the specific functions that matter to them to get the best price. More often than not, the price and specifications mentioned on the vendor’s pricing page can be negotiated. Vendors may be willing to offer discounts or an extra number of licenses for multi-year contracts. Negotiation on implementation, support, and other professional services are also crucial. Buyers should ensure they’ll receive adequate support to get the product up and running.

Final decision

Before deciding to purchase the software, testing it for a short period is advisable. The day-to-day users of the software are the best individuals to perform this test. They can use and analyze the software product's capabilities and offer valuable feedback.

In most cases, software service providers offer a short-term product trial. If the selection team is satisfied with what the software offers, buyers can proceed with the purchase or contracting process.
